### Provisioning newly added PowerEdge servers in the cluster
|
|
|
To provision newly added servers, wait till the iDRAC IP addresses are automatically added to the *idrac_inventory*. After the iDRAC IP addresses are added, launch the iDRAC template on the AWX UI to provision CentOS custom OS on the servers.

To access the Cobbler dashboard, enter `https://<IP>/cobbler_web` where `<IP>` is the Global IP address of the management station. For example, enter
|
|
|
`https://100.98.24.225/cobbler_web` to access the Cobbler dashboard.

+>>__Note__: After the Cobbler Server provisions the operating system on the servers, IP addresses and hostnames are assigned by the DHCP service.
|
|
|
+>>* If a mapping file is not provided, the hostname to the server is provided based on the following format: **computexxx-xxx** where "xxx-xxx" is the last two octets of the Host IP address. For example, if the Host IP address is 172.17.0.11 then the assigned hostname by Omnia is compute0-11.
|
|
|
+>>* If a mapping file is provided, the hostnames follow the format provided in the mapping file.
